Join the Kelly® Professional & Industrial team as a Data Examiner II with the Arizona Department of Economic Security (AZDES) – Division of Benefits and Medical Eligibility (DBME), a critical state agency supporting Arizona communities through benefits and eligibility services.

Why you should apply to be a Data Examiner II

Pay Rate: $16.00 per hour
Location: Phoenix, AZ (Onsite)
Schedule: Day Shift | Monday–Friday, 8:00 AM – 5:00 PM
Contract Duration: 1 year

What's a typical day as a Data Examiner II? You will:
  • Review applications and supporting documents for accuracy and completeness

  • Prepare, process, and validate eligibility-related documentation

  • Barcode, scan, index, upload, and re-index documents in OnBase and/or HEAPlus

  • Ensure documents are assigned to the correct eligibility type

  • Send notices and emails to applicants as required

  • Update and correct address information in state systems

  • Document actions taken and research returned mail

  • Sort, prepare, and route returned mail appropriately

  • Follow established administrative, office, and unit guidelines

  • Collaborate with team members and escalate issues when necessary

  • Provide bilingual support or use translation services as needed
